Overview

Wei Ouyang is a researcher affiliated with Beijing Normal University in China, specializing in Environmental Science with a substantial focus on related subfields such as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, Pollution, Environmental Chemistry, Water Science and Technology, and Ecology.

Their publication record includes contributions to several frequent venues, notably:

  • The Science of The Total Environment
  • Journal of Hazardous Materials
  • Environmental Pollution
  • SSRN Electronic Journal
  • Water Research

The main topics covered in Wei Ouyang's research encompass:

  • Heavy metals in environment
  • Arsenic contamination and mitigation
  • Soil and Water Nutrient Dynamics
  • Mercury impact and mitigation studies
  •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ies
  • Pharmaceutical and Antibiotic Environmental Impacts
  • Toxic Organic Pollutants Impact

Frequent collaborators include Mengchang He, Xitao Liu, Chunye Lin (notably in two separate counts), and Baodong Wang.
